Module avrd::atmega162 [] [src]

The AVR ATmega162 microcontroller

Variants

Pinout Package Operating temperature Operating voltage Max speed
standard 0°C - 0°C 1.8V - 5.5V 0 MHz

Registers by module (not exhaustive)

PORT modules

  • PORTA
  • PORTB
  • PORTC
  • PORTD
  • PORTE

USART modules

  • USART0
  • USART1

JTAG modules

  • JTAG

EEPROM modules

  • EEPROM

Constants

ACSR

Analog Comparator Control And Status Register.

ASSR

Asynchronous Status Register.

CLKPR

Clock prescale register.

DDRA

Port A Data Direction Register.

DDRB

Port B Data Direction Register.

DDRC

Port C Data Direction Register.

DDRD

Port D Data Direction Register.

DDRE

Data Direction Register, Port E.

EEAR

EEPROM Address Register Bytes.

EEARH

EEPROM Address Register Bytes high byte.

EEARL

EEPROM Address Register Bytes low byte.

EECR

EEPROM Control Register.

EEDR

EEPROM Data Register.

EMCUCR

Extended MCU Control Register.

ETIFR

Extended Timer/Counter Interrupt Flag register.

ETIMSK

Extended Timer/Counter Interrupt Mask Register.

EXTENDED
GICR

General Interrupt Control Register.

GIFR

General Interrupt Flag Register.

HIGH
ICR1

Timer/Counter1 Input Capture Register Bytes.

ICR3

Timer/Counter3 Input Capture Register Bytes.

ICR1H

Timer/Counter1 Input Capture Register Bytes high byte.

ICR1L

Timer/Counter1 Input Capture Register Bytes low byte.

ICR3H

Timer/Counter3 Input Capture Register Bytes high byte.

ICR3L

Timer/Counter3 Input Capture Register Bytes low byte.

LOCKBIT
LOW
MCUCR

MCU Control Register.

MCUCSR

MCU Control And Status Register.

OCDR

On-Chip Debug Related Register in I/O Memory.

OCR0

Timer/Counter 0 Output Compare Register.

OCR2

Output Compare Register.

OCR1A

Timer/Counter1 Output Compare Register A Bytes.

OCR1AH

Timer/Counter1 Output Compare Register A Bytes high byte.

OCR1AL

Timer/Counter1 Output Compare Register A Bytes low byte.

OCR1B

Timer/Counter1 Output Compare Register B Bytes.

OCR1BH

Timer/Counter1 Output Compare Register B Bytes high byte.

OCR1BL

Timer/Counter1 Output Compare Register B Bytes low byte.

OCR3A

Timer/Counter3 Output Compare Register A Bytes.

OCR3AH

Timer/Counter3 Output Compare Register A Bytes high byte.

OCR3AL

Timer/Counter3 Output Compare Register A Bytes low byte.

OCR3B

Timer/Counte3 Output Compare Register B Bytes.

OCR3BH

Timer/Counte3 Output Compare Register B Bytes high byte.

OCR3BL

Timer/Counte3 Output Compare Register B Bytes low byte.

OSCCAL

Oscillator Calibration Value.

PCMSK0

Pin Change Enable Mask.

PCMSK1

Pin Change Mask Register 1.

PINA

Port A Input Pins.

PINB

Port B Input Pins.

PINC

Port C Input Pins.

PIND

Port D Input Pins.

PINE

Input Pins, Port E.

PORTA

Port A Data Register.

PORTB

Port B Data Register.

PORTC

Port C Data Register.

PORTD

Port D Data Register.

PORTE

Data Register, Port E.

SFIOR

Special Function IO Register.

SP

Stack Pointer.

SPCR

SPI Control Register.

SPDR

SPI Data Register.

SPH

Stack Pointer high byte.

SPL

Stack Pointer low byte.

SPMCR

Store Program Memory Control Register.

SPSR

SPI Status Register.

SREG

Status Register.

TCCR0

Timer/Counter 0 Control Register.

TCCR2

Timer/Counter Control Register.

TCCR1A

Timer/Counter1 Control Register A.

TCCR1B

Timer/Counter1 Control Register B.

TCCR3A

Timer/Counter3 Control Register A.

TCCR3B

Timer/Counter3 Control Register B.

TCNT0

Timer/Counter 0 Register.

TCNT1

Timer/Counter1 Bytes.

TCNT2

Timer/Counter Register.

TCNT3

Timer/Counter3 Bytes.

TCNT1H

Timer/Counter1 Bytes high byte.

TCNT1L

Timer/Counter1 Bytes low byte.

TCNT3H

Timer/Counter3 Bytes high byte.

TCNT3L

Timer/Counter3 Bytes low byte.

TIFR

Timer/Counter Interrupt Flag register.

TIMSK

Timer/Counter Interrupt Mask Register.

UBRR0H

USART Baud Rate Register High Byte.

UBRR0L

USART Baud Rate Register Low Byte.

UBRR1H

USART Baud Rate Register Highg Byte.

UBRR1L

USART Baud Rate Register Low Byte.

UCSR0A

USART Control and Status Register A.

UCSR0B

USART Control and Status Register B.

UCSR0C

USART Control and Status Register C.

UCSR1A

USART Control and Status Register A.

UCSR1B

USART Control and Status Register B.

UCSR1C

USART Control and Status Register C.

UDR0

USART I/O Data Register.

UDR1

USART I/O Data Register.

WDTCR

Watchdog Timer Control Register.